Gold(I)-catalyzed Conia-ene reaction of beta-ketoesters with alkynes.
Kennedy-Smith, Joshua J; Staben, Steven T; Toste, F Dean.

ABSTRACT
The intramolecular addition of beta-ketoesters to unactivated alkynes under neutral conditions and at room temperature is described. The method employs triphenylphosphinegold(I) cation as a catalyst for the formation of exo-methylenecycloalkanes. Both monocyclic and bicyclic cyclopentanes and cyclohexanes can be formed in excellent yields and with good diastereoselectivity.
